The functional exterior design of both the 2016 Cadillac CTS-V and ATS-V – and available carbon fiber and track packages – helps contribute to their enhanced aerodynamic performance.

To further increase their aerodynamic abilities, both the 2016 CTS-V and ATS-V models are built on the lightweight structure on non-V-Series model. Almost every exterior panel on both the 2016 CTS-V and ATS-V is unique, from the fascias and fenders, to the hood, rear spoiler and rocker moldings – and every one was designed to support each model’s capability and aerodynamic performance.

Unique front and rear fascias – on both the 2016 CTS-V and ATS-V – provide optimal aero performance, with larger grille openings in the front fascia to feed more air to the new twin-turbocharged engine.

Even the mesh pattern of the signature grille openings – of each model – is enlarged to allow more air into the radiator and multiple heat exchangers.

In addition, the V-Series models’ rocker moldings and rear spoiler are aero-optimized.

Both the 2016 CTS-V and ATS-V come equipped with a standard carbon fiber hood and an available, all-carbon fiber package that takes aero performance and mass optimization to higher levels. It includes a more aggressive front splitter, hood vent trim, rear diffuser and a taller, rear spoiler, with exposed-carbon fiber on the CTS-V.
